Skip to Navigation Skip to Content

Barcelino Superstore Opens at the Embarcadero Center

Barcelino celebrated the Grand Opening of their latest store at Four Embarcadero Center on Thursday, December 3 with a champagne reception and an informal fashion presentation. The impressive 10,000 sq. foot space showcases hand-tailored Italian suits and sportswear for men alongside luxurious cocktail dresses and evening gowns for women.